FO continues efforts for trapped Pakistanis in Libya

ISLAMABAD: Following special orders of Pakistani premier, Foreign Office (FO) reiterated continuation of its maximum effort to bring back the isolated Pakistanis in Libya.


Pakistan FO said that two relief centres have been set up in Tripoli and Benghazi where hundreds of Pakistani nationals desirous of repatriation have been housed. Two injured Pakistanis have been evacuated through Tunisia.

Hectic efforts are also underway to obtain release of any detained Pakistanis in Libya. In all, 83 prisoners have already been released through Embassy’s efforts in the last two days alone. These had been in prison for many months.

Earlier, the Pakistan’s Foreign Office confirmed that at least 3,000 to 6,000 nationals has trammeled in crisis-hit Libya.
